Rice Field Art (3)
The residents of Inakadate have been drawing pictures with rice since 1993. Each year farmers in the town of Inakadate in Aomori prefecture create works of crop art by growing a little purple and yellow-leafed kodaimai rice along with their local green-leafed tsugaru-roman variety. -
Tall Timber Resort - Durango, Colorado (2)
This is Tall Timber Resort, near Durango, Colorado, our family's favorite getaway spot. It's a small, secluded, family-owned five-star resort, reachable only by helicopter or historic train. The food is sumptuous, the accommodations are private and well-appointed, there's a great library, and you're surrounded by unspoiled mountains, forests and rivers. They have a new zip-line attraction as well as golf, pool and hot tubs, massage and lots of hiking. No place like it, well worth a trip. http://www.talltimberresort.com/ [Photos by Lance Thompson] -
